Beschreibung:

This book focuses on innovative treatment options for breast cancer, including surgery, radiotherapy, systemic therapy and of course immunotherapy that is changing outcomes in some aggressive breast cancer histotypes. Subsequent chapters also address the ongoing emerging research in the screening, diagnostics, and management of all subtypes of breast cancers. All current landscapes and future perspectives in each molecular subtype: luminal, HER2-positive, and triple-negative breast cancers are discussed within the different chapters.Breast cancer is still the most common cancer and cause of cancer deaths among women worldwide. The improvement of breast cancer outcome appears to be strictly related to the validation of precise biomarkers that enable us to better select personalized approaches in breast cancer management.The closing chapters deal with the challenges of conducting research in the  era of precision medicine for cancer. The book is edited and authored by leading experts in this field and will be of interest for clinicians and scientists alike.
